#1 Le 20/08/2007, à 23:37
- Syrion
[R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
C'est à n'y rien comprendre... depuis que j'ai installé gdm (ce n'est peut-être qu'une coïncidence), lorsque je lance éclipse depuis un terminal grâce à
eclipse
ou
/usr/bin/eclipse
, ça marche.
Où est le problème ? les mêmes commandes dans un raccourci plante !
J'ai un raccourci dans le menu Gnome développement et un sur une barre gDesklet, et quelque soit celui sur lequel je clique j'obtient une popup avec :
JVM terminated. Exit code=1
/usr/lib/jvm/java-6-sun/bin/java
-Djava.library.path=/usr/lib/jni
-Dgnu.gcj.precompiled.db.path=/var/lib/gcj-4.1/classmap.db
-Dgnu.gcj.runtime.VMClassLoader.library_control=never
-Dosgi.locking=none :::::::::::::: /usr/lib/eclipse/eclipse.ini ::::::::::::::
-Xms128m
-Xmx384m
-XX:MaxPermSize=196m
-jar /usr/lib/eclipse/startup.jar
-os linux
-ws gtk
-arch x86_64
-launcher /usr/lib/eclipse/eclipse
-name Eclipse
-showsplash 600
-exitdata 7e8047
-install /usr/lib/eclipse
-vm /usr/lib/jvm/java-6-sun/bin/java
-vmargs
-Djava.library.path=/usr/lib/jni
-Dgnu.gcj.precompiled.db.path=/var/lib/gcj-4.1/classmap.db
-Dgnu.gcj.runtime.VMClassLoader.library_control=never
-Dosgi.locking=none :::::::::::::: /usr/lib/eclipse/eclipse.ini ::::::::::::::
-Xms128m
-Xmx256m
-XX:MaxPermSize=196m
-jar /usr/lib/eclipse/startup.jar
quelqu'un a eu le pb ? comment expliquer que les raccourcis fassent planter éclipse ?
Dernière modification par Syrion (Le 04/09/2007, à 13:22)
Ubuntu 24.04.4 amd64 sur Dell XPS 7590 15"
Ubuntu Server 24.04.4 Eeepc 1215P
Ubuntu 24.10 sur Ryzen 5 5600X, 32Go DDR4-3600, NVidia RTX 3060Ti
Hors ligne
#2 Le 22/08/2007, à 19:58
- Syrion
Re : [R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
up
Ubuntu 24.04.4 amd64 sur Dell XPS 7590 15"
Ubuntu Server 24.04.4 Eeepc 1215P
Ubuntu 24.10 sur Ryzen 5 5600X, 32Go DDR4-3600, NVidia RTX 3060Ti
Hors ligne
#3 Le 22/08/2007, à 21:26
- Link31
Re : [R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
Je ne sais pas d'où vient le problème, mais il te suffit de modifier la commande associée aux raccourcis pour qu'elle devienne /usr/bin/eclipse, et ça devrait fonctionner.
Pour avoir une idée de la cause du problème, lance la commande fautive du raccourci dans un terminal.
Hors ligne
#4 Le 22/08/2007, à 22:16
- Syrion
Re : [R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
la commande /usr/bin/eclipse est celle qui était lancée par les raccourcis. c'est pourquoi je ne comprenais pas d'où venais le pb.
En fait, merci pour ton aide mais ça venait d'ailleuirs, je vais devoir déposer un message dans un autre forum concernant la commande /bin/more.....
Pourquoi ? En fait, /usr/bin/eclipse est un shell donc le but est de lancer /usr/lib/eclipse/eclipse avec les bons arguments. Comme j'ai vue qu'il ne prenait pas en compte le contenu du fichier eclipse.ini dans /usr/lib/eclipse, j'ai ajouté des lignes au script pour qu'il lise le contenu avec /bin/more et ajoute ce contenu ) la ligne de commande.
Le pb, c'est que /bin/more ne donne pas le même résultat lancé par le bureau ou par un shell !!
Pourquoi ??? je ne sais pas, mais j'en ai eu la preuve dans mon.xsession-errors lorsque j'ai ajouté au shell des "echo". /bin/more lancé par le bureau pollue le contenu de sa sortie avec " ::::::::: nomDuFichier :::::::::" !
Résultat la commande est invalide et le lancement crashe.
Donc j'ai remplacé more par cat et plus de pb.
Ubuntu 24.04.4 amd64 sur Dell XPS 7590 15"
Ubuntu Server 24.04.4 Eeepc 1215P
Ubuntu 24.10 sur Ryzen 5 5600X, 32Go DDR4-3600, NVidia RTX 3060Ti
Hors ligne
#5 Le 22/08/2007, à 23:03
- Link31
Re : [R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
En effet, j'ai lu un peu vite. Content que tu aies résolu ton problème.
Hors ligne
#6 Le 22/08/2007, à 23:14
- Syrion
Re : [R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
sauf qu'il en soulève un autre, d'où mon autre message sur le [shell]
Ubuntu 24.04.4 amd64 sur Dell XPS 7590 15"
Ubuntu Server 24.04.4 Eeepc 1215P
Ubuntu 24.10 sur Ryzen 5 5600X, 32Go DDR4-3600, NVidia RTX 3060Ti
Hors ligne
#7 Le 22/08/2007, à 23:22
- Link31
Re : [R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
Je ne vois pas vraiment le rapport entre more et xsession-errors...
Et pour lancer une commande d'après des arguments présents dans un fichier, c'est :
cat fichier | xargs commande
Pour passer des commandes à un programme qui attend une entrée utilisateur, c'est :
commande < fichier
Je ne vois pas ce que vient faire more là-dedans.
Hors ligne
#8 Le 25/08/2007, à 14:48
- Syrion
Re : [RESOLU-eclipse]crash au démarrage lorsque lancé depuis un raccourci
Je ne vois pas vraiment le rapport entre more et xsession-errors...
Moi je le vois : quand tu lances un shell via un raccourci( lanceur, menu) stdout est par défaut ~/xsession-errors
Et la réponse est la suivante, trouvée sur linuxfr.org : si le stdin de more n'est pas attaché à un terminal (cas des raccourcis du burreau), il affiche en première ligne ":::::: /chemin/du/fichier ::::::::".
Dernière modification par Syrion (Le 25/08/2007, à 14:50)
Ubuntu 24.04.4 amd64 sur Dell XPS 7590 15"
Ubuntu Server 24.04.4 Eeepc 1215P
Ubuntu 24.10 sur Ryzen 5 5600X, 32Go DDR4-3600, NVidia RTX 3060Ti
Hors ligne